About The Position

A CAD Technician is tasked with utilizing CAD software to prepare control drawings, as well as overseeing quality assurance and validation of control panels. The technician collaborates with electrical designers and engineers to deliver comprehensive and accurate drawing sets for assigned projects.

Requirements

  • Associates degree, Equivalent Trade school Degree, or CAD software Experience.
  • Knowledgeable in electrical CAD software programs (AutoCAD Electrical, EPLAN, SolidWorks Electrical, etc.).
  • General knowledge of electrical circuitry, NFPA, NEC, and/or IEC codes.

Responsibilities

  • Completes drawings thoroughly and accurately.
  • Self-checking of all work for accuracy.
  • Continuous improvement in acquiring skills for using software tools developed at RoviSys.
  • Ability to recognize and offer suggestions for continued improvement within the CAD Team for Efficiency and Accuracy.
  • Completes drawing drafting tasks including Panel Layout, Power Distribution, I/O Connections, Field Termination Details, Location and Cable Pull Details, HVAC Flow Diagrams, Controls P&IDs, Network Architectures, and Bill of Materials.
  • Prepare all drawings to conform to customers’ and RoviSys’ standards and specifications.
  • Provide technical support during panel fabrication.
  • Conduct inspections of finished control enclosures at panel fabrication shops.
  • Conduct a field inspection of the control panel and instrumentation to verify accuracy prior to finalizing the drawing revision.
  • Engaging with both the designer and engineer throughout their design phase through structured meeting formats.
  • Support engineers and field technicians during commissioning and testing phases of the project.
